Transaction 498cc19691a84a3b82c770b44ca1e6dc298f605a38396b30762fbb6a00c28437
1 Input
1 Output
-
498cc19691a84a3b82c770b44ca1e6dc298f605a38396b30762fbb6a00c28437:0
- value
- 62050609
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d8f750ae63dcabff744ab0295574568be9d9cd0
- address
- bc1qpk8h2zhx8h9tla6y4vpf2469dzlfm8xstayncd